Why did the dad bring a ladder to the bar?
He heard the drinks were on the house!

"On the house" is bar shorthand for free drinks, but the dad takes it literally — the drinks are physically on top of the building, hence the ladder. The joke requires knowing bar lingo to appreciate how perfectly the misinterpretation is set up.
Deliver with a shrug of complete reasonableness, as if bringing a ladder to a bar is the most obvious preparation in the world given the circumstances.
